Reflecting on the Ethereum Merge of 2022

The Ethereum Merge in September 2022 marked a significant shift in the cryptocurrency landscape, transitioning Ethereum from a proof-of-work (PoW) to a proof-of-stake (PoS) consensus mechanism. This change rendered traditional GPU mining for Ethereum obsolete, leaving many miners with substantial hardware investments and uncertain futures. In the aftermath, miners have explored various avenues to repurpose or liquidate their equipment.

Assessing Post-Merge GPU Mining Profitability

Immediately following the Merge, the profitability of GPU mining experienced a sharp decline. Alternative PoW coins saw a temporary influx of miners, leading to increased difficulty and reduced rewards. Many miners observed that the revenue generated did not cover operational costs, prompting a reevaluation of mining strategies. The swift adjustment in hash rates across various coins underscored the challenges of maintaining profitable GPU mining operations in the new landscape.

Exploring Alternative Uses for Mining Hardware

With traditional mining avenues less lucrative, miners have considered several options for their existing hardware:

  1. Transition to High-Performance Computing (HPC) and AI Applications:
    • The computational power of GPUs makes them well-suited for tasks beyond cryptocurrency mining, such as artificial intelligence (AI) model training and other HPC tasks. Some large-scale mining operations have begun repurposing their infrastructure to offer HPC services, capitalizing on the growing demand in sectors like AI and machine learning. This pivot requires significant investment in new hardware and expertise but offers a viable path forward for those equipped to make the transition.
  2. Selling Hardware to Recoup Investments:
    • For miners unable or unwilling to transition to HPC services, selling their GPUs presents a practical solution. Given the high demand for GPUs in gaming, content creation, and AI research, miners can liquidate their assets to recover a portion of their initial investment. Engaging with reputable bulk buyers or specialized resellers can streamline this process, ensuring fair market valuations and efficient transactions.
  3. Participating in Distributed Computing Projects:
    • Miners interested in contributing to scientific research can allocate their GPU resources to distributed computing projects like Folding@Home or BOINC. These platforms utilize donated computational power to advance studies in fields such as molecular biology and astrophysics. While not financially rewarding, participation offers a sense of community and purpose.

The Environmental Impact of E-Waste

1. Preventing Pollution and Toxic Waste Contamination

One of the biggest dangers of electronic waste is the release of hazardous substances into the environment. Many electronic components contain toxic materials such as lead, mercury, cadmium, and brominated flame retardants. If disposed of improperly in landfills, these materials can seep into the soil and water supply, posing serious health risks to humans and wildlife.

By recycling electronic devices, these hazardous materials are properly handled, reducing the potential for soil and water contamination. Professional e-waste recyclers follow stringent regulations to ensure toxic substances are either neutralized or safely repurposed in new technology, preventing environmental damage.

2. Reducing Carbon Footprint

Manufacturing new electronics requires significant amounts of energy and raw materials. Mining metals such as gold, silver, and palladium for use in electronics is a resource-intensive process that results in deforestation, water pollution, and greenhouse gas emissions.

When you recycle or resell your old tech, you extend the life cycle of these materials, reducing the need for new mining operations. Refurbishing and reusing existing components also cuts down on energy consumption in production, ultimately reducing the carbon footprint associated with electronic manufacturing.

3. Minimizing Landfill Waste

Electronic waste is one of the fastest-growing waste streams in the world. According to the Global E-Waste Monitor, millions of tons of e-waste are discarded every year, with only a small percentage being properly recycled. This trend is unsustainable, as landfills continue to overflow with hazardous waste that could be repurposed.

Proper disposal through certified recycling programs ensures that obsolete tech doesn’t end up clogging landfills. Instead, functional components are extracted and reintroduced into the production cycle, minimizing overall waste.

The Importance of Resource Conservation

1. Reducing Energy Demand in Manufacturing

Extracting and processing raw materials for electronics require vast amounts of energy. According to studies, producing a single laptop can generate up to 300 kilograms of carbon emissions due to the extensive processing of raw materials.

By recycling or repurposing electronic components, manufacturers can significantly cut down on energy usage. Using reclaimed metals, plastics, and glass in the production of new devices conserves resources and reduces emissions associated with mining and refining new materials.

2. Preserving Non-Renewable Resources

Many of the materials used in electronics, such as lithium for batteries and tantalum for capacitors, are derived from non-renewable sources. These resources are finite, and excessive mining depletes them at an unsustainable rate.

Recycling ensures that these materials remain in circulation, extending their usability and reducing the strain on natural reserves. This approach benefits both the economy and the environment by promoting sustainable resource management.

Maximize IT Asset Value: Secure, Sustainable & Profitable ITAD Solutions

Effective Information Technology Asset Disposition (ITAD) is essential for organizations to manage the end-of-life process for IT equipment securely, sustainably, and in compliance with regulatory standards. Implementing a comprehensive ITAD strategy not only safeguards sensitive data but also maximizes asset value and minimizes environmental impact.

Key Components of an Effective ITAD Strategy:

  1. Comprehensive Asset Inventory:
    • Maintain detailed records of all IT assets, including specifications, locations, and ownership. Regular audits ensure accurate tracking and inform disposition decisions.
  2. Data Security and Destruction:
    • Prioritize secure data erasure to prevent unauthorized access. Utilize certified data destruction methods, such as those conforming to NIST 800-88 Rev1 standards, to ensure complete data sanitization.
  3. Regulatory Compliance:
    • Adhere to relevant regulations governing data protection and environmental responsibility, including GDPR, HIPAA, and RCRA. Compliance mitigates legal risks and upholds organizational integrity.
  4. Environmental Responsibility:
    • Implement eco-friendly recycling practices to minimize e-waste. Partner with certified recyclers to ensure responsible disposal and support sustainability initiatives.
  5. Value Recovery:
    • Assess assets for potential refurbishment and resale to recoup value. This approach reduces waste and contributes to cost savings.
  6. Certified ITAD Partnerships:
    • Collaborate with certified ITAD providers that adhere to industry standards, such as R2 or e-Stewards, ensuring secure and environmentally responsible asset disposition.
  7. Employee Training and Awareness:
    • Educate staff on ITAD policies and procedures to ensure consistent adherence and mitigate risks associated with improper asset handling.

By integrating these components into an ITAD strategy, organizations can effectively manage the lifecycle of their IT assets, ensuring data security, regulatory compliance, environmental stewardship, and value recovery.

Nvidia 5000 Series GPUs: The Next Generation of Gaming and Performance

The gaming and graphics world is abuzz with Nvidia’s latest innovation—the 5000 series GPUs. Building on the groundbreaking advancements of the 4000 series, the 5000 series is set to redefine performance benchmarks for gamers, creators, and professionals alike. Let’s  explore the key performance specifications, compare the 5000 series to its predecessors (the 4000 and 3000 series), and help you determine if it’s time to upgrade.

Performance Specifications: A Leap Forward

The Nvidia 5000 series GPUs are powered by the Blackwell architecture, delivering unprecedented performance and efficiency. Some highlights of the 5000 series include:

  • Core Count and Clock Speeds:
    • Up to 25% more CUDA cores compared to the 4000 series.
    • Boost clock speeds reaching up to 2.9 GHz, enhancing real-time rendering and AI performance.
  • Memory and Bandwidth:
    • Equipped with GDDR7 memory, offering a 40% increase in bandwidth over the 4000 series’ GDDR6X.
    • Memory capacities range from 12GB to 24GB on flagship models, catering to demanding workloads and next-gen gaming.
  • Ray Tracing and AI Enhancements:
    • Third-generation RT cores improve ray-tracing performance by up to 30%.
    • Fourth-generation Tensor cores accelerate AI-driven features, such as DLSS 4.0, which delivers smoother gameplay and improved upscaling quality.

Note: These metrics above apply when running DLSS 4.

Comparison: Nvidia 5000 vs. 4000 vs. 3000 Series

Performance Gains

The 5000 series offers a significant performance boost over the 4000 and 3000 series. For instance, the RTX 5090, Nvidia’s flagship GPU, boasts:

  • A 30% increase in FPS in 4K gaming compared to the RTX 4090.
  • Nearly double the performance of the RTX 3090 in AI-intensive tasks and rendering workloads.
  • Improved latency, making it ideal for competitive gamers who demand split-second responsiveness.

Feature Enhancements

While the 4000 series introduced DLSS 3.0 and improved ray tracing, the 5000 series takes these technologies to the next level:

  • DLSS 4.0: A game-changer for frame generation, delivering lifelike visuals without compromising performance. Compared to DLSS 3.0, the new version reduces input lag and offers better scaling for 1440p and 4K resolutions.
  • Ray Tracing: Games with heavy ray-tracing workloads see a 25-30% improvement in rendering times, ensuring smoother and more realistic visuals.

About Electronics Recycling

Individuals and businesses can sell separate electronic components, like GPUs, CPUs, and RAM, to recyclers. They can also sell unused electronics as whole units, such as gaming PC setups, mining rigs, and personal computers. The recycling process involves disassembling these pre-owned electronics to reclaim metals and other valuable components.

If the components can be refurbished, the electronic is repaired and resold. If the device is too damaged, recyclers remove materials like batteries, bulbs, metal, plastic, glass, and wiring that can be reused in new electronics. These components are sorted by material and then cleaned before recycling. Reusing these components reduces the need to procure more natural resources for manufacturing new electronics. Recyclers also take careful measures to dispose of toxic electronic waste properly to protect the environment.

Data Security Measures

Before you donate or sell computer components, confirm that the recycling company is reputable and has data security policies in place. This helps protect you from future data breaches involving your recycled technology. Here are some of the data security efforts sellers and recyclers may take to protect sensitive information:

1. Restore Factory Settings

Remove all personal information from your computer or gaming console before selling or donating it. This includes documents, images, and other private data. Transfer all the content you want to save to an external storage device. This could be a flash drive, memory card, or hard drive. After you have safely moved your personal information to your storage device and removed the device from your computer, you can restore your computer to its factory settings. This option can be found in the general settings and can’t be reversed once completed.

2. Overwrite Remaining Data

Recycling companies use secure software solutions to remove leftover data from donated technology. One of the most common wiping solutions is overwriting software. Overwriting software identifies and replaces a file’s original data to make it unreadable. The overwritten data is challenging for future owners to recover, improving the device’s data security before recycling. Recycling companies that hold NAID AAA Certification have proven that their data-wiping processes comply with strict security standards.

3. Destroy Physical Components

Some data storage may be impossible to remove from your electronics. If electronics recycling companies can’t wipe or overwrite your devices, they may destroy the physical components. This includes disassembling the product and breaking, crushing, or shredding it. The recycler should provide the seller with a certificate of destruction to prove that all secure data was disposed of properly. 

4. Track Ownership

Some recycling companies may track the donated and recycled devices. This involves keeping a record of the original owner and who purchased the recycled components. Tracking this information provides evidence if the original owner experiences a data breach related to their donation.

Electronic Waste Recycling Centers

E-waste recycling centers properly dispose of old computers or electronic parts by shredding the pieces and sorting through them for reusable metals. Many items contain gold, silver, platinum, or palladium, which are reusable when properly collected. Recycling centers also sort non-metallic items and send plastic to be used in new products.

Check with your local government for information on where to find electronic recycling centers, their operating hours, and what items they take. This information may be available in a brochure or on their website. Some technology-based companies also accept electronics for recycling.

Local Recycling

City governments may have specific days or weeks of the year when old electronics can be left on a curb for collection or taken to specially designated bins around the area. Some recycling centers or secondhand companies charge for e-waste, while sponsored recycling days can provide residents with a free, convenient option. Contact your local government for more information on the next responsible recycling event.

Donation

Most old computer hardware is still usable and can be reused or repurposed. Several nonprofits and educational programs accept used electronics. These donations give others access to technology and help stretch the limited budget of schools. Call local charities or schools to see if they accept hardware donations.

Some national organizations accept functioning computer parts to refurbish and give to communities or individuals in need. Others will accept unusable devices for their parts and use the proceeds to fund their programs. These donations may be tax-deductible, so make sure to get a receipt.

Trade-in 

Some major manufacturers and licensed dealers offer trade-in programs for used electronics. Trade-ins are a convenient way to upgrade your old equipment without contributing to e-waste. Companies will reuse or refurbish your used products and may provide free shipping so you don’t have to visit in person. Research your brand-name electronics to determine if this is an option for your device model. Cell phones, laptops, and tablets are common items eligible for trade-in deals.
